Government agency data shows 47 natural disaster events for ZIP 45325 in Farmersville, OH. These include 17 hailstorms, 16 floods, and 8 tornadoes. Total documented property damage amounts to $2.1M. Across all recorded events, 3 deaths have been attributed to natural disasters in this area.
With 17 recorded incidents (36% of all events), hailstorms are the leading natural hazard for this ZIP code. Hail-related events have caused a combined $6K in documented property damage. The most recent recorded hailstorm occurred on Apr 29, 2025.
There have been 16 recorded floods in this area, representing 34% of all disaster events. Of these, 2 (13%) were rated at severity level 4 or 5 — the most intense on the normalized scale. The highest recorded severity for flood-related events here is 4/5 (severe). Flood-related events have caused a combined $231K in documented property damage. The most recent recorded flood occurred on Mar 20, 2020.
Farmersville has experienced 8 tornadoes on record. Tornado-related events have caused a combined $727.5K in documented property damage. The most recent recorded tornado occurred on Jun 18, 2021.
Farmersville has experienced 4 blizzards on record. Of these, 2 (50%) were rated at severity level 4 or 5 — the most intense on the normalized scale. The highest recorded severity for winter storm events here is 5/5 (extreme). Winter storm events have caused a combined $526K in documented property damage. 3 fatalities have been attributed to blizzards in this area. The most recent recorded blizzard occurred on Feb 1, 2011.
Farmersville has experienced 2 extreme cold events on record. One event reached severity level 4 or 5 on the normalized scale. The highest recorded severity for cold-related events here is 4/5 (severe). Cold-related events have caused a combined $640K in documented property damage. The most recent recorded extreme cold event occurred on Apr 6, 2007.
The most significant disaster event on record for Farmersville was Frost/Freeze on Apr 6, 2007, which caused $540K in property damage. Another major event was Winter Storm (Jan 6, 1996), causing $500K in damages.
